Abstract
The utility model provides a valve body machining tool for an adjusting valve, which comprises a bottom plate, V-shaped positioning blocks, counterweight supports, high-strength large hexagon bolts for steel structures, side positioning blocks and V-shaped pressing plates, wherein the bottom plate is a round steel plate with a central through hole, the two V-shaped positioning blocks are mutually arranged on the bottom plate in parallel and are connected with the bottom plate through stud bolts and positioning pins, the counterweight supports are vertically arranged relative to the V-shaped positioning blocks and are mutually parallel and are connected with the bottom plate through stud bolts, the counterweight supports are provided with the adjustable high-strength large hexagon bolts for steel structures, the side positioning blocks are arranged outside the V-shaped positioning blocks in parallel and are connected with the bottom plate through hexagon socket head screws, and meanwhile the side positioning blocks are provided with the adjustable high-strength large hexagon bolts for steel structures. The advantages are that: the device is convenient and quick to assemble and disassemble, reduces the time length of auxiliary work such as scribing, alignment and the like, compresses auxiliary time, firmly clamps, effectively avoids the conditions of deformation, movement and vibration of the valve body, and can effectively control the deviation of the machining dimension of the adjustable valve body due to accurate positioning.

Technical Field
The utility model relates to the field of valves, in particular to a processing tool for a valve body of a regulating valve.
Technical Field
The existing regulating valve body is machined, the valve body is clamped by a chuck on a lathe spindle box, then the lathe spindle box rotates at a high speed with the chuck according to a programmed program, and the cutting speed, the feeding amount and the cutting amount of the lathe are controlled to carry out machining. The valve body is clamped by the chuck on the lathe spindle box, the labor intensity is high, the auxiliary work of scribing and alignment is long, the valve body is easy to deform, move and vibrate when the lathe is used for cutting, the machining size precision is not easy to control, and the production efficiency is low.

Detailed Description
In order to make the objects and technical solutions of the present utility model more clear, the present utility model will be further described with reference to the accompanying drawings.
A processing tool for a valve body of an adjusting valve comprises a bottom plate 1, a V-shaped positioning block 2, a counterweight support 3, a high-strength large hexagon bolt 4 for a steel structure, a side positioning block 5 and a V-shaped pressing plate 6. The bottom plate 1 be the circular steel sheet of central through-hole, two V type locating pieces 2 mutual parallel arrangement are on bottom plate 1, are connected with bottom plate 1 through stud 7, locating pin 9, counter weight support 3 set up perpendicularly for V type locating piece 2 to two counter weight supports 3 are parallel to each other, are connected with bottom plate 1 through stud 7, are equipped with adjustable high strength big hexagon bolt 4 for the steel construction on the counter weight support 3, side locating piece 5 in V type locating piece 2 outside parallel arrangement, be connected with bottom plate 1 through hexagon socket head cap screw 8, be equipped with adjustable high strength big hexagon bolt 4 for the steel construction on the side locating piece 5 simultaneously.
When the adjusting valve is used, the side flange of the adjusting valve body 10 is placed in the V-shaped positioning block 2, the V-shaped pressing plate 6 is buckled at the other end of the side flange of the adjusting valve body 10, the adjusting valve body 10 is fastened, and the adjusting valve body 10 is aligned by adjusting the high-strength large hexagon bolts 4 for the steel structures on the counterweight support 3 and the side positioning block 5.
